Subject: Re: [PATCH] io_uring/net: don't truncate the bundle segment length to int

Baul Lee <baul.lee@xbow.com> writes:

> io_bundle_nbufs() works out how many buffers a short bundle transfer
> consumed by walking the mapped iovec and subtracting each segment from the
> transferred length:
>
> 	do {
> 		int this_len = min_t(int, iov[nbufs].iov_len, ret);
>
> 		nbufs++;
> 		ret -= this_len;
> 	} while (ret);
>
> iov_len is a size_t while this_len is an int, so a segment longer than
> INT_MAX comes out negative.  ret then grows instead of shrinking and the
> loop keeps walking, reading past the end of the array it was handed.
>
> The recv bundle path can hand it such a segment.  io_recv_buf_select()
> folds sr->mshot_total_len into arg.max_len, and that field is unsigned and
> taken straight from sqe->optlen:
>
> 	if (sr->flags & IORING_RECV_MSHOT_LIM)
> 		arg.max_len = min_not_zero(arg.max_len, sr->mshot_total_len);
>
> With sqe->len left at 0 nothing else lowers it, so arg.max_len can be
> 0xffffffff.  io_ring_buffers_peek() clamps each buffer against that rather
> than against INT_MAX and records an iov_len above INT_MAX; a short receive
> over that bundle then enters the loop above.
>
> An unprivileged multishot IORING_OP_RECV with IOSQE_BUFFER_SELECT and
> IORING_RECVSEND_BUNDLE, a provided buffer ring registered with
> IOU_PBUF_RING_INC holding two buffers, and two bytes of data is enough to
> reach it.  The two-entry iovec is a 32-byte kmalloc:
>
>   BUG: KASAN: slab-out-of-bounds in io_bundle_nbufs+0x114/0x1a8
>   Read of size 8 at addr ffff0000d39a1b68 by task io_repro/165
>   Call trace:
>    io_bundle_nbufs+0x114/0x1a8
>    io_recv_finish+0x138/0xa38
>    io_recv+0x38c/0x1008
>    io_issue_sqe+0xc4/0x155c
>    io_submit_sqes+0x6d0/0x1fac
>    __arm64_sys_io_uring_enter+0x30c/0x1180
>
>   Allocated by task 165:
>    __kmalloc_noprof+0x1b8/0x444
>    io_ring_buffers_peek+0x57c/0xbb4
>    io_buffers_peek+0x168/0x2a0
>    io_recv+0x598/0x1008
>
>   The buggy address is located 8 bytes to the right of
>   allocated 32-byte region [ffff0000d39a1b40, ffff0000d39a1b60)
>
> Count in size_t.  ret is positive by the time the loop runs, since the
> function returns early for ret <= 0, so widening loses nothing; this_len
> stays bounded by ret, and the mapped length is never less than ret, so the
> walk ends inside the array.
>
> Fixing it here rather than by capping arg.max_len keeps the accounting
> correct for every caller and does not disturb buffer selection: an
> arg.max_len of 0 is a distinct "not set yet" state that
> io_ring_buffers_peek() tests before it applies its own INT_MAX default,
> and pre-filling it changes which bundles get expanded.
>
